Drag Queen Bingo brings family law community together for akt

Coram Chambers’ Drag Queen Bingo raised £6,021.30 for akt, supporting LGBTQ+ youth at risk of homelessness.

Coram Chambers hosted a vibrant Drag Queen Bingo night, bringing together the family law community to celebrate modern families and support LGBTQ+ young people.

The event raised £6,021.30 for akt, a charity supporting LGBTQ+ youth at risk of homelessness.

Matching support from Morrison’s

Morrison’s agreed to match-fund our fundraising. This raised the total for akt to £6,021.30. This support will help akt continue its valuable work for young people in need.

Community support and sponsors

The event was sponsored by Our Family Wizard, who backed the entertainer Envy and DJ Lloyd-Paul Dixon from Party with Ginger. The Phoenix Arts Club hosted the evening in the heart of London’s West End.

Coram Chambers recognises the importance of celebrating all families. Events like Drag Queen Bingo are a fun way to unite colleagues, raise funds and support important causes in family law.
